on a serious note, your question currently cannot be answered accurately as full multiplayer has not been able to be played by anyone here (to my knowledge).

this being said if you like objective based gameplay, i.e. kdr and kills in general takes a back-seat to an overlying larger purpose then that leans more towards brink. if you enjoy taking more bullets to kill, requiring accuracy rather than “speed of spray”, then likely again it points more towards brink (haven’t played crysis 2 demo or such so not sure if this is the case, seems so from the vids however). if you like DM TDM and the like as game modes then brink is not the game for you as brink does not have these game modes.

at any rate brink is more akin to tf2 than battlefield. also do yourself a favor and don’t try to suggest that battlefield has any semblance of teamwork on these forums… this would be one way to acquire aforementioned “finest sarcastic jackassery”.

tldr; if you are looking for a game similar to cod or battlefield look ye elsewhere as brink is not similar to these, and those here like it that way.

Don’t like the look of the automatic weapon handling in the Crysis2 beta footage. It seems to be standard practice to hold down your fire button and spray a clip at opponent. There is no substantial recoil or spread penalty as an incentive to fire in bursts.

For me this makes the weapons seem like 1 dimensional laser bullet guns.
